[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: master 6eeab90632: Don't accept whitespace or hex floats in rgbi: co
From: |
Mattias Engdegård |
Subject: |
Re: master 6eeab90632: Don't accept whitespace or hex floats in rgbi: colour specs |
Date: |
Mon, 7 Mar 2022 10:31:35 +0100 |
7 mars 2022 kl. 01.34 skrev Po Lu <luangruo@yahoo.com>:
> AFAICT, there are no other implementations of such an rgbi color
> specification (please correct me if I'm wrong.)
The syntax is from X11, or at least that is why Emacs supports it.
> I don't think there's a chance that the user will type any of those by
> mistake. Besides, the documentation can always be amended, and that
> function has no other specification. So I disagree that it doesn't do
> the user a service.
These unintended extensions do not provide the user with any additional
expressive power so there seems to be little reason for them. For that matter,
I believe that extensions should be motivated by needs, not by implementation
happenstance. Don't you agree?
In any case we are debating angels dancing on a pinhead. I just fixed it
because I made the mistake to begin with, and I don't think you should elevate
my errors to holy scripture quite yet (please wait until I'm dead).